Official Description
Provides both a deep understanding of the fundamentals of virtual reality (VR) and practical experience implementing VR systems. Topics covered include visual and audio display technology, tracking, human perception and psychophysics, building user interfaces for VR, and analyzing VR experiences. Course Information: 3 undergraduate hours. 4 graduate hours. Prerequisite: CS 225.
